
In this immersive virtual reality experience from Stanford University’s Virtual Human Interaction Lab, spend days in the life of someone who can no longer afford a home. Interact with your environment to attempt to save your home and to protect yourself and your belongings as you walk in another’s shoes and face the adversity of living...

Игра 'Becoming Homeless: A Human Experience' – это душераздирающий и глубоко эмпатичный взгляд на жизнь бездомного человека. Она погружает в суровые реалии выживания на улице, заставляя принимать сложные решения о еде, безопасности и здоровье. Графика хоть и простая, но эффективно передаёт чувство отчаяния и безысходности. Симулятор предлагает не просто механическое выживание, а даёт возможность прочувствовать, как рушится самооценка и достоинство. Особое внимание уделяется взаимодействию с другими людьми – как с другими бездомными, так и с обычными прохожими. Эти встречи показывают, как много значат простые проявления человечности. Несмотря на медленный темп и отсутствие динамичного геймплея, игра оставляет сильное впечатление. Она заставляет задуматься о проблеме бездомности и о том, как легко любой человек может оказаться в подобной ситуации. 'Becoming Homeless' – это не развлечение, а скорее интерактивный урок сочувствия, который может изменить ваше восприятие мира. Это важный опыт, который трудно забыть.

I experienced this app on the Oculus Rift with Touch Controllers So, there's lots of jokes to be made in the review section for this game. However, this app takes homelessness serious and hopefully, so do the reviewers. This is a mostly cinematic experience, with very limited interactiveness. You basically point at objects with your hand (motion controller) and press trigger. You also gaze at certain things. There are three main scenarios. The first is you're being evicted from your apartment after not being able to pay rent because you've been laid off from your job. The second scenario is you're living in your vehicle, when a cop rolls up on you. Lastly, you are in a city bus at night where other homeless take shelter. You hear very brief stories on how other homeless people ended up in their predicament. I think the experience could have been made grittier. It could have been made with better graphics. There could have been a more detailed story of your homeless experience. But it's free. It's a student project. Download if you think this might interest you.
